How much does it cost to rent an apartment in New Kingstown?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
New Kingstown 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,546 | $910 | $2,196 |
New Kingstown 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,762 | $1,160 | $3,500 |
New Kingstown 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,993 | $1,550 | $2,545 |
New Kingstown 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,397 | $2,101 | $2,750 |

Largest Available New Kingstown and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in New Kingstown, PA is found at Stone Gate Village in the West Shore Mechanicsburg neighborhood and is 1,500 square feet priced from $2,061. Arcona Strand has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,460 square feet and currently listed start at $1,875.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in New Kingstown:
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
---|---|---|---|
Stone Gate Village | The Tanzanite | 1,500 Sq Ft | $2,061 |
Arcona Strand | SALONA | 1,460 Sq Ft | $1,875 |
Georgetown Crossing | The Yorkshire | 1,377 Sq Ft | $1,969 |
Frederick Court | Three Bedroom | 1,350 Sq Ft | $1,550 |
Cheapest Available New Kingstown and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
As of August 04, 2025 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in New Kingstown, PA is the Three Bedroom Model starting from $1,550 at Frederick Court . The second most affordable New Kingstown 3 Bedroom is the GIBSON Model at Arcona Strand starting at $1,725 in the West Shore Mechanicsburg neighborhood.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in New Kingstown is currently $1,993.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in New Kingstown:
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
---|---|---|
Frederick Court | Three Bedroom | $1,550 |
Arcona Strand | GIBSON | $1,725 |
Georgetown Crossing | The Yorkshire | $1,969 |
Stone Gate Village | The Tanzanite | $2,061 |
